The invention discloses methacrylate modified organosilicon quaternary ammonium salt as well as a preparation method and application thereof. The methacrylate modified organosilicon quaternary ammonium salt disclosed by the invention simultaneously has a siloxane group, a cationic quaternary ammonium group and a methacrylate group, can achieve functions of a silane coupling agent, enhances the bonding strength and durability of the prosthesis, and can endow the bonding interface with an antibacterial function through the cationic quaternary ammonium group, thereby effectively avoiding secondary caries and obviously improving the long-term treatment effect of bonding repair. Fast atom bombardment man spectrometry and liquid scintillation counting have been used to study the biodegradation of a novel cationic surfactant In live sludge. The rates of primary biodegradation and the extent of complete miner allzation were determined. Furthermore, an Intermediate degradation product was Identified and Its rates of formation and subsequent removal have been established. These data find utility In assessing the environmental safety of the surfactant and the accuracy of various environmental fate models.
